Cheating of businessman and court: Case registered against Shankar Kalbhor of Kohinoor Trade Home

Pune : NpNews24 OnlinePune Crime | A fraud case has come to light where a businessman and the court were cheated by making a duplicate stamp of a company and signature. A case has been registered against a father-son duo at the Pimpri police station. The incident took place between December 4, 2017 to March 28, 2019.

 

The accused have been identified as Rohit Shankar Kalbhor (35) and Shankar Namdev Kalbhor (58), both residing at SN 25, plot number 238, Jain Temple Road, Near Madanlal Dhingra Ground, Pradhikaran. Pavan Manoharlal Lodha, (34), a resident of Nitesh Kunj, plot number 2, sector 24, Nigdi Pradhikaran has lodged a complaint at the Pimpri police station.

 

Lodha has filed an application in the court through Adv Sagar Tilak. The court has taken note of the application and has asked the police to lodge a complaint and carry out an investigation.

 

Complainant Pawan Lodha has a company Axayya Alloys Pvt Ltd at Kharabwadi in Chakan. The scrap is used to manufacture aluminium rods and sheds. Kalbhor supplies scrap to the complainant. Rohit Kalbhor supplied aluminium scrap from November 2016 to January 2017 through Kohinoor Trade Home Pvt Ltd. The complainant’s company paid the money with taxes to Kalbhor’s company.

 

Meanwhile, Rohit Kalbhor asked for a deposit from the complainant. Accordingly, the complainant gave 7 cheques of Rs 10 lakh and a cheque of Rs 8 lakh 92 thousand 658 totalling 8 cheques of Rs 78 lakh 92 thousand 658 favouring Rohit Kalbhor’s Kohinoor Trade Home Pvt Ltd.

 

The complainant had given all the money but the accused misused the cheque and submitted it in the bank by writing the date as December 4, 2017.

 

The complainant had a doubt that the cheque may be misused and asked the officials of Bhosari branch of Cosmos Bank to stop payment of the cheque. Hence, the cheques could not be cleared.

 

Hence, the accused sent a legal notice to the complainant and filed a case in the Pimpri court against the complainant and his company’s director.

 

The accused while filing a case in the court used the complainant’s sign and stamps of the company to submit the company’s accounts books. They also submitted a false complaint and false affidavit. The court sent the documents submitted to check the handwriting. During checking, it came to light that there is a lot of difference in the signature of the complainant and the signature on the account books. A case has been registered against the accused for cheating the complainant and the court at the Pimpri police station.

 

Meanwhile, a case of cheating by getting the ancestral property transferred in their favour has been registered against accused Shankar Namdev Kalbhor, Rohit Shankar Kalbhor and Rohan Shankar Kalbhor at the Nigdi police station. Shankar Kalbhor’s brother Gyanoba Namdev Kalbhor filed a complaint on January 20, 2022.

 

Shankar Kalbhor had made a false thumb impression of the complainant’s father and fake signature of the complainant, the complaint says.
